PAE800 series, Powersolve
Single Output 800W Power Supplies Feature Fully Programmable Output Voltage And Current

Powersolve has launched a new series of AC/DC power supplies designed to provide up to 800W from a low profile 1U high metal case. The seven models in the PAE800 series all feature a 90-264VAC input voltage range with active PFC and forced active current sharing for parallel operation.
Models in the PAE800 series offer single outputs of 12V, 15V, 24V, 30V, 36V, 48V and 60VDC, programmable between 0% and 105%,. Output current is also programmable between 0% and 105%. Efficiency levels are high at 93%.
A +5V, 0.5A standby output is also provided and operating temperature range is -25 to +60ºC.
PAE800 units have a built-in I²C serial data bus and an RS232 function is available as an option. The PAE800 power supplies measure 249x127x41mm have full safety approvals and EMC compliance to EN55022”B”.
The new units offer protection against overload, over voltage, over temperature and short circuit while fault conditions are displayed using intelligent LEDs. Remote on/off, remote sense and power good signals ease system integration.
